Features:
4 CWDM lanes Mux/De-mux design
Build in CDR on both TX and RX
Up to 25.78Gbps Data rate per wavelength
Up to 2km transmission on SMF
Electrically hot-pluggable
Digital Diagnostics Monitoring Interface
Compliant with QSFP28 MSA with LC connector
Case operating temperature range:0°C to 70°C
Power dissipation < 3.5 W
Application:
100G Ethernet
